CuratorSeedProposalTriggerJob.RunAsync

// Id: #26873
using PurchaseAgent.Slices.Curator.Application.Discovery.Curator.Orchestrator.Workflows;

var curatorSeedProposalTriggerJob = Activate<CuratorSeedProposalTriggerJob>();
await curatorSeedProposalTriggerJob.RunAsync(null);

Parameters

RecurringJobId
"curator.seed-proposal.trigger"
Time
1780102801
CurrentCulture
""

State

05/30/2026 01:00:08 (+5.872s) Failed

An exception occurred during performance of the job.

System.InvalidOperationException (purchaseagent@purchaseagent-purchaseagent-5dcfb6686d-x4jcq:1)

AgentService /a2a/curator.market-research-deep-dive/tasks/29d711b0-63c9-4f58-b32b-0bf8cf3840ca finished with state 'TASK_STATE_FAILED': step 'research' failed: LlmCallStep failed: Invalid URI: The URI is empty.

System.InvalidOperationException: AgentService /a2a/curator.market-research-deep-dive/tasks/29d711b0-63c9-4f58-b32b-0bf8cf3840ca finished with state 'TASK_STATE_FAILED': step 'research' failed: LlmCallStep failed: Invalid URI: The URI is empty.
   at PurchaseAgent.Application.Clients.AgentService.HttpAgentServiceClient.PollAgentInvocationResponseAsync(String slug, String taskId, CancellationToken cancellationToken) in /src/src/PurchaseAgent.Application/Clients/AgentService/HttpAgentServiceClient.cs:line 226
   at PurchaseAgent.Application.Clients.AgentService.HttpAgentServiceClient.InvokeAgentAsync[TPayload,TResponse](String slug, TPayload payload, CancellationToken cancellationToken) in /src/src/PurchaseAgent.Application/Clients/AgentService/HttpAgentServiceClient.cs:line 96
   at PurchaseAgent.Slices.Curator.Application.Briefing.Curator.Research.MarketResearchService.GenerateRawProposalsAsync(CancellationToken ct) in /src/src/PurchaseAgent.Slices.Curator/Application/Briefing/Curator/Research/MarketResearchService.cs:line 68
   at PurchaseAgent.Slices.Curator.Application.Briefing.Curator.Workflows.CuratorSeedProposalJob.ExecuteAsync(CancellationToken ct, String hangfireJobId) in /src/src/PurchaseAgent.Slices.Curator/Application/Briefing/Curator/Workflows/CuratorSeedProposalJob.cs:line 116
   at PurchaseAgent.Slices.Curator.Application.Briefing.Curator.Workflows.CuratorSeedProposalJob.ExecuteAsync(CancellationToken ct, String hangfireJobId) in /src/src/PurchaseAgent.Slices.Curator/Application/Briefing/Curator/Workflows/CuratorSeedProposalJob.cs:line 291
   at PurchaseAgent.Slices.Curator.Application.Discovery.Curator.Orchestrator.Workflows.CuratorSeedProposalTriggerJob.RunAsync(CancellationToken ct) in /src/src/PurchaseAgent.Slices.Curator/Application/Discovery/Curator/Orchestrator/Workflows/CuratorSeedProposalTriggerJob.cs:line 52
   at InvokeStub_TaskAwaiter.GetResult(Object, Object, IntPtr*)
   at System.Reflection.RuntimeMethodInfo.Invoke(Object obj, BindingFlags invokeAttr, Binder binder, Object[] parameters, CultureInfo culture)

+717ms Processing

Server:
purchaseagent@purchaseagent-purchaseagent-5dcfb6686d-x4jcq:1
Worker:
3cb69a78

+6ms Enqueued

Triggered by recurring job scheduler

05/30/2026 01:00:01 Created